Why Manual Feedback Collection Fails Small Service Businesses

Most service business owners collect feedback the same way they always have: ask at the end of a job, wait for Google reviews to trickle in, occasionally send a follow-up email. This approach has three fatal flaws.

The timing problem: Customer satisfaction peaks in the first 24 hours after service. Manual follow-up -- which typically happens days later, if at all -- misses this window. Automated systems that trigger within 24 hours achieve 50-70% response rates, versus 25-30% for delayed manual emails.

The consistency problem: Manual collection depends on your team remembering to ask -- which is the first thing that gets skipped when things get busy. Automation fires the same sequence for every completed job, every time, regardless of workload.

The routing problem: Most businesses treat all feedback responses identically. A 5-star customer gets the same follow-up as a 1-star customer. Intelligent routing -- different sequences based on satisfaction score -- is what turns a feedback system into a feedback loop that actually closes.

The 4-Stage AI Customer Satisfaction Feedback Loop

A complete CSAT automation system for small service businesses has four stages: Capture, Score, Route, and Act. Each stage builds on the previous one, and the system only delivers its full value when all four are connected.

Stage 1: Capture -- Collect Satisfaction Signals at the Right Moment

The first stage is triggering a satisfaction survey at the optimal moment after service delivery. For most service businesses, this is within 2-24 hours of job completion -- early enough that the experience is fresh, late enough that the customer has had time to assess the result.

The survey itself should be short. A single question -- "How satisfied were you with your experience today?" on a 1-5 or 1-10 scale -- is enough to trigger the routing logic in Stage 3. You can add an optional open-text field for comments, but the primary goal of Stage 1 is to get a response, not to conduct a research study.

Channel selection matters. SMS surveys consistently outperform email for response rates in service business contexts. A text message with a one-tap rating link achieves open rates above 90% and response rates of 50-70%. Email is a viable secondary channel, particularly for customers who prefer it, but SMS should be your primary trigger for post-service feedback.

Stage 2: Score -- Classify Every Response Automatically

Once a customer submits their rating, the system needs to classify it into one of three buckets that will determine what happens next:

  • Promoters (4-5 stars / 9-10 NPS): Highly satisfied customers who are likely to recommend you and write positive reviews if asked at the right moment.
  • Passives (3 stars / 7-8 NPS): Satisfied but not enthusiastic. They will not actively promote you, but they are not at risk of posting a negative review. A follow-up that addresses any minor friction can move them into the Promoter category.
  • Detractors (1-2 stars / 0-6 NPS): Unhappy customers who are at high risk of churning, posting a negative review, or both. These require immediate, personalized service recovery.

If the customer also left a text comment, AI sentiment analysis can add a second layer of classification -- identifying specific themes (pricing concerns, communication issues, quality problems) that help your team understand what went wrong and respond appropriately.

This scoring step is what makes the system intelligent. Without it, you are just collecting data. With it, every response automatically triggers the right next action.

Stage 3: Route -- Send Every Customer Down the Right Path

Routing is where the feedback loop earns its ROI. Based on the score from Stage 2, each customer enters one of three automated sequences:

The Promoter Path: Convert Satisfaction Into Public Reviews

Promoters are your most valuable asset -- they are already happy, and they are statistically the most likely to write a positive review if asked immediately after expressing satisfaction. The Promoter path capitalizes on this window.

Within minutes of a 4-5 star response, the system sends a follow-up message: "We are so glad you had a great experience! Would you mind sharing it on Google? It takes less than 60 seconds and helps other local homeowners find us." The message includes a direct link to your Google review page -- no searching required.

This timing is critical. Businesses that ask for reviews immediately after a positive feedback response see 3-4x higher review conversion rates than those who send a generic review request days later. The customer is already in a positive emotional state and has just articulated their satisfaction -- the ask feels natural, not transactional.

The Passive Path: Identify and Remove Friction

Passives receive a slightly different follow-up: "Thank you for your feedback! Is there anything we could have done to make your experience even better?" This open-ended question often surfaces minor friction points -- a scheduling inconvenience, a communication gap, a small quality issue -- that the customer did not feel strongly enough to rate poorly but that, if addressed, would move them into the Promoter category.

Responses from Passives are routed to a team member for review. Many of these conversations result in a simple fix -- a follow-up call, a small discount on the next service, or a clarification -- that converts a lukewarm customer into a loyal one.

The Detractor Path: Service Recovery Before Public Escalation

Detractors require the fastest and most personalized response. Within minutes of a 1-2 star rating, two things happen simultaneously:

  1. An internal alert goes to the business owner or manager with the customer's name, rating, and any comments they left.
  2. The customer receives an immediate, empathetic automated message: "We are sorry to hear your experience did not meet your expectations. A member of our team will reach out within [X hours] to make this right."

This two-pronged response accomplishes something critical: it signals to the unhappy customer that they have been heard and that action is coming, which dramatically reduces the likelihood of an immediate public review. Research shows that customers who receive a prompt, empathetic response to a complaint are 70% less likely to post a negative review publicly -- and are actually more likely to become loyal customers than those who never had a problem at all.

The internal alert ensures your team has everything they need to make a recovery call within the promised window. The AI can also draft a suggested response script based on the customer's specific comments, so the team member is not starting from scratch.

Stage 4: Act -- Close the Loop and Feed the Intelligence Back

The fourth stage is what separates a feedback loop from a feedback collection exercise. Acting on the data means two things: resolving individual customer situations, and using aggregate patterns to improve your service delivery.

Individual Resolution Tracking

Every Detractor response should be tracked through to resolution. Did the team member make the recovery call? What was the outcome? Did the customer's sentiment change? A simple CRM tag or status field -- "Recovery Initiated," "Recovery Successful," "Churned" -- gives you visibility into how well your service recovery process is working and where it is breaking down.

Businesses that track recovery outcomes consistently find that 60-70% of Detractors who receive a prompt, personalized recovery attempt either remain customers or upgrade their public review. That is a significant revenue retention number for a process that runs largely on autopilot.

Pattern Recognition and Service Improvement

Over time, your feedback data becomes a diagnostic tool. If 30% of your Detractor comments mention "scheduling" in a given month, that is a signal to examine your booking and confirmation process. If Passive responses consistently mention "communication during the job," that is a training opportunity for your field team.

AI sentiment analysis can surface these patterns automatically -- grouping comments by theme and flagging recurring issues without requiring you to read every response manually. Building the System: What You Need and How to Connect It

The Core Components

A functional CSAT automation system for a small service business requires four connected components:

  1. A trigger source: Your scheduling software, CRM, or job management platform (e.g., Jobber, ServiceTitan, HubSpot, or a simple Google Sheet) that signals when a job is complete.
  2. A survey delivery tool: An SMS or email platform that sends the feedback request and captures the response. Tools like AskNicely, Zonka Feedback, or a custom SMS workflow via your CRM handle this.
  3. A routing engine: Logic (often built in your CRM or automation platform) that reads the score and triggers the appropriate follow-up sequence.
  4. An alert and tracking system: A notification channel (SMS, email, or Slack) that alerts your team to Detractor responses, plus a simple tracking mechanism for recovery outcomes.

Integration and Compliance

One compliance note: FTC and Google guidelines prohibit review gating -- you cannot selectively ask only happy customers for public reviews. The correct approach is to ask all customers for feedback first, then route Promoters to Google as a natural next step. Detractors go to private service recovery, not a blocked path. This is both compliant and more effective.

What to Expect: Benchmarks and ROI

A well-configured SMS-first system should achieve 50-70% response rates within 30 days. Businesses implementing the Promoter path see a 40-80% increase in monthly Google review volume within 60-90 days. Detractor recovery rates of 60-70% are achievable when your team responds within 2 hours -- recovery drops sharply after 24 hours.

The revenue case has two components. Retention: if your average customer is worth $1,200 per year and you recover 10 Detractors per month, that is $144,000 in annual revenue retention. Acquisition: moving from a 4.2 to a 4.7 star rating -- a realistic outcome of consistent CSAT automation -- drives an average 15-25% increase in new customer inquiries from local search. Four Mistakes That Kill CSAT System Results

Avoid these common pitfalls: Sending the survey too late (3-7 days post-service kills response rates -- trigger within 24 hours). Making the survey too long (one question gets 50-70% response; ten questions gets 5-10%). Ignoring Passives (a simple "what could we have done better?" follow-up converts many into Promoters). Not closing the loop on Detractors (promising a follow-up and not delivering is worse than no response at all -- assign a team member and set a deadline).

Getting Started: A Phased Approach

You do not need to build the entire system at once. Start with the trigger and the Promoter path in Week 1 -- connect your job completion signal to an SMS platform and send a review request to every 4-5 star responder. Add the Detractor path in Week 2 (internal alert plus empathetic response). Add the Passive path and tracking in Week 3. By Week 4, you have a complete, running feedback loop.
